Q. I am a new 4K TV owner and I have DIRECTV. Any news on what 4K events DIRECTV will have on this month? — Wayne, Fairfax, Virginia.

Wayne, you’re in luck. DIRECTV has just released its November schedule for 4K programming and, as usual, it’s dominated by sports.

The 4K lineup is highlighted by two Notre Dame games. The Fighting Irish will play Florida State on November 10 at 7:30 p.m. ET, and Syracuse on November 17 at 2:30 p.m. ET. Both contests will be live in 4K HDR on DIRECTV’s 4K special events channel, 106.

DIRECTV this month also will air one NBA game live and in 4K (but not HDR): Philadelphia vs Toronto on November 12 at 7:30 p.m. ET. The game will also be on channel 106.

On November 23, the satcaster will offer the pay-per-view match between Tiger Woods and Phil Michelson in 4K HDR (channel 106) at 3 p.m. ET.  Warner Media, which is owned by DIRECTV’s owner, AT&T, has set the event’s price at $19.99, but it’s unknown if DIRECTV will require a higher price for the 4K presentation. Consult your on-screen guide for more information.

Finally in sports, DIRECTV will air the following English Premier League games in 4K (not HDR):

November 11: Manchester City v. Manchester United, 11:15 a.m. ET on channel 106

November 24: Tottenham v. Chelsea City, 12:15 p.m. ET on channel 106

DIRECTV has also scheduled three recorded musical concerts in 4K this month. All will air at 9 p.m. ET on channel 104

November 10 — Jason Aldean
November 17 — Bad Company at Red Rocks (HDR)
November 24 — Leonard Cohen Tribute Concert (HDR)
